簡體   English   中英

使用ASP.NET的SharePoint用戶/ Windows身份驗證

[英]SharePoint user/Windows authentication w/asp.net

如何使用asp.net讀取SP用戶?

有沒有我可以關注的如何在asp.net中讀取當前共享點用戶的詳細示例? 以及我可以獲得有關當前共享點用戶的哪些信息? 它包括全名,部門和電子郵件地址嗎?

我在MSDN上找到了此鏈接 但是,由於我不熟悉Sharepoint,因此我正在尋找有關如何執行此過程的詳細信息。 我也看過以前的stackoverflow問題,但這還不夠。

看一下SPContext對象。 例如,在構建自定義Web部件(例如,Visual Web部件)時,可以使用SPContext.Current.Web.CurrentUser檢索當前用戶。 它將為您提供一個SPUser對象,其中包含有關當前人員的詳細信息。

SPUser對象將返回基本屬性,例如用戶名,顯示名,電子郵件地址等。 如果要檢索所有用戶配置文件屬性(例如,他可以在其配置文件中輸入的用戶興趣),則將有些復雜。 您必須查詢用戶個人資料服務。 請在此處查看有關如何使用服務器端對象模型執行此操作的更多信息。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M